Ich entwickle auf einer Windows-Maschine. Der einzige Ort, den ich für die Linux-Kommandozeile brauche, ist Git Bash. Das Problem ist: Wenn ich es öffne, bin ich im Home-Verzeichnis. Ich muss das Verzeichnis in meinen Arbeitsbereich ändern, wie:
cd ../../../d/work_space_for_my_company/project/code_source
Kann ich dies in eine .sh-Datei einbinden, damit ich es nicht mehr von Hand eingeben muss? Dies sollte einfach sein, aber ich habe keine Kenntnisse über die Linux-Befehlszeile. Ich bin sehr dankbar, wenn Sie mir zeigen können, wie Sie diese .sh-Datei erstellen.
C:\Windows\System32\bash.exe -i -c 'cd /mnt/c/Data; exec "${SHELL:-bash}"'
Ihrer Information, hier ist die WSL-Bash-Alternative (oder wenn Sie cmder verwenden cmd /c "C:\Windows\System32\bash.exe -i -c 'cd /mnt/c/Data; exec "${SHELL:-bash}"'" -new_console:t:Data
), bei -i
der die Pfeiltasten funktionieren
ctrl-r../d
und der Befehl wird angezeigt und geben Sie enter ein. Im Allgemeinen sollten Sie einige Minuten in das Erlernen der Verwendung des Befehlsverlaufs investieren, und dann werden Sie ihn häufig verwenden, wenn Sie die verschiedenen Git-Befehle wiederholen.